Disclosure: MyeLearningWorld is reader-supported. We may receive a commission if you purchase through our links.


How to Learn R Online: The Best Resources for Beginners

Last Updated:

Photo of author

By Scott Winstead

how to learn r

Are you interested in improving your programming skills by learning R? Wondering how to learn R as quickly and easily as possible?

R is a versatile language used for statistical computing, data analysis, and graphical representation. It’s also open source, which means that anyone can contribute to its development. R is growing in popularity among statisticians and data analysts, and it’s known for its ease of use and flexibility.

Whether you’re a beginner or an experienced data analyst, plenty of resources are available to help you master this powerful programming language.

In the guide below, we’ll take a look at some of the best options for learning R online, including courses from platforms like LinkedIn Learning and others.

So, what are you waiting for? Let’s get started!


Why Learn R?

There are many reasons why you might want to learn R.

First, it is free and open source, meaning that anyone can use and contribute to the language.

Because R is a powerful programming language used by statisticians, data scientists, and researchers, it has a ton of useful applications. R is extremely versatile and capable of handling everything from simple data manipulation to complex machine learning tasks.

Learning R can open up new career opportunities. With its growing popularity in the data science community, employers are increasingly looking for candidates with skills in R.

Whether you’re looking to change careers or advance in your current field, learning R can give you the skills you need to succeed.


Online Courses Offer the Best Way to Learn R Skills

The best way to learn R is by taking an online course. Here’s why:

  • Online courses are flexible and convenient. You can access them anytime, anywhere with an internet connection. This means you can fit learning R into your busy schedule without having to commute to a physical location or juggle class times around your work or family commitments. In addition, most online courses offer self-paced learning, so you can move through the material at your own speed.
  • Online courses provide structure and support. A good online course will provide you with clear learning goals and a step-by-step plan for achieving them. It will also give you access to a community of fellow learners, so you can get help and feedback when you need it.
  • Online courses are affordable. Online courses are often way more affordable than traditional in-person courses, giving you a college-level education at a tiny fraction of the cost.

Fortunately, there are a number of excellent online platforms that offer classes on R.

Here are some of the best ones worth checking out:

LinkedIn Learning

LinkedIn Learning LinkedIn Learning

LinkedIn Learning offers over 18,000 online courses in a wide range of subjects, and it's a great platform for professionals looking to gain valuable new skills.

We earn a commission if you make a purchase, at no additional cost to you.

LinkedIn Learning is an online education platform that offers over 18,000 courses in a wide range of subjects, including business, design, technology, and more. The platform also offers a number of courses on R.

Whether you’re a complete beginner or a seasoned R user, there’s an online course on R that’s right for you.

Popular R courses and learning paths on LinkedIn Learning include:

  • Learning R
  • R Essential Training: Wrangling and Visualizing Data
  • Master R for Data Science
  • Advance Your Skills as an R Expert
  • R for Excel Users

All of the courses are self-paced, so you can complete them at your own speed. Each course also comes with a certificate of completion, which can be added to your LinkedIn profile.

And they’re all taught by experts in the field, so you can be confident you’re learning up-to-date, accurate information.

Check out our LinkedIn Learning pricing article for details on all of their plans and features.

Click here to try LinkedIn Learning free for 30 days.



Skillshare is an online learning platform that offers a wide range of classes on various topics, including programming.

The platform’s R courses are taught by experienced instructors and cover topics such as data visualization and machine learning.

With Skillshare, unlimited access to all of the classes on the platform is included with one subscription.

In addition, Skillshare offers a free trial so that you can try out the platform before committing to a paid subscription.


Coursera Plus

Coursera Plus is a subscription service that gives you unlimited access to over 7,000 courses and Specializations on Coursera.

With Coursera Plus, you can learn at your own pace, on your own schedule, and with no deadlines.

You’ll also have access to exclusive learning content, including projects, quizzes, and professional development resources.

And you can earn certificates of completion for the courses you finish.

Whether you’re looking to learn R to take your career to the next level or just explore a new hobby, Coursera Plus has you covered.


A Final Word on How to Learn R Online

So you want to learn R? The best way to start is by taking online courses. With online courses, you can learn at your own pace, on your own schedule, and in the comfort of your own home. You’ll also have access to expert instructors and a community of fellow learners.

Most importantly, with online courses, you can get a college-level education without breaking the bank.

Once you have a basic understanding of the language, don’t stop there! Keep learning and expanding your skill set so that you can use R for all sorts of data analysis tasks.

Do you have any other favorite resources that we didn’t mention? Let us know in the comments below – we would love to hear from you!

Have any questions about how to learn R? Let us know by commenting below.

Leave a Comment